The Advisory Board Company Media Planner Salaries in Austin

The average The Advisory Board Company Media Planner in Austin earns an estimated $69,883 annually. The Advisory Board Company's Media Planner compensation is $9,640 more than the US average for a Media Planner.

In Austin, The Marketing Department at The Advisory Board Company earns $1,889 more on average than the Operations Department.

Media Planner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Media Planner at companies similar size to The Advisory Board Company reported making $68,833, while the average male Media Planner at similar sized companies reported making $81,575.

Media Planner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Hispanic or Latino Media Planner at companies similar size to The Advisory Board Company reported making $84,000, while the average African American/Black Media Planner at similar sized companies reported making $60,000.

How Media Planners at The Advisory Board Company Rate Their Compensation

The majority of Media Planners at The Advisory Board Company believe they're not compensated fairly. 100% of Media Planners at The Advisory Board Company say they receive annual bonuses, and the vast majority (83%) are satisfied with their benefits.
